Binkley Elementary Charter School is a public charter school located in Santa Rosa, California. Founded in 2002, Binkley has been providing quality education to students from kindergarten through fifth grade for over 18 years. The school's mission is to provide an innovative and engaging learning environment that encourages creativity, critical thinking, and collaboration among its students.
At Binkley Elementary Charter School, the curriculum focuses on developing each student’s individual strengths while also teaching them how to work together as part of a team. Through hands-on activities and projects, students are encouraged to explore their interests and develop skills that will help them succeed both inside and outside of the classroom. In addition to core subjects such as math, science, language arts, social studies, physical education/health sciences and art/music appreciation classes are offered throughout the year.
The faculty at Binkley Elementary Charter School consists of highly qualified teachers who strive to create a safe learning environment where all children can reach their full potential. They use evidence-based instruction methods combined with technology integration strategies so that every student can have access to high-quality educational experiences regardless of their background or ability level.
In addition to academics, Binkley offers extracurricular activities such as sports teams (soccer & basketball), afterschool clubs (chess club & robotics club) and field trips throughout the year which allow students to further explore their interests while having fun with friends!
